I was a 2pad smoker, ultra lt 100's. Smoked for 20 years. I vaped while smoking and cutting down for about a month(including 3 weeks with blu's) until things 'clicked'. I still had urges for a couple of weeks, i vaped and vaped hard thru them. I was vaping 18mg, and thought about upping to 24 in some of the more 'rough times' but in the end made it thru. Exclusively vaping now for...6 or 7 weeks now. I forget.

It gets easier. Stay strong. Up the nic level if you need to.

Oh, I also carried around an open pack in my car that first week I went tobacco free. In the end, I gave them away and felt better to be 'free' of them.

Good luck!

Oh, take long slow drags. Hold it in your mouth for a second, then inhale slowly(if you lung inhale) and then exhale out your nose. It helps. The longer the vape is inside the body, the more nic you absorb. Nic absorbs slower and lower when vaping compared to the stinkies.

I was a 3 PAD for over 35 years. If I can make a suggestion, throw the unopened pack away. I kept a pack the same way when I started vaping and every time I saw it I knew I could just grab one when I was having the urge. When I threw the Pack away I noticed I did not have the craving anymore. I knew it was just me and my vaping buddy from that day forward. I am now 75 days analog free.

Good Luck and thank you for sharing your story.
